概要 |
VANETs (Vehicular Ad hoc Networks) have pulled in enormous considerations because of their real-time application and business value. Due to the limited bandwidth of the wireless interface, dynamic top...ology, frequently disconnected networks, the communication between vehicles is a challenging task. Clustering is seen as one of the possible solutions to achieve effective communication in VANETs; this research proposes a Clustering Adaptive Elephant Herd Optimization (CAEHO) technique for VANETs. The proposed CAEHO protocol is used to form optimized clusters for robust communication. Cluster head (CH) selection depends upon the fuzzy logic method by selecting parameters like connectivity levels, lane weighting, direction and speeds of vehicles. Based on a fitness function, these parameters are utilized to choose the optimal route between sender and receiver. The NS2 platform is used to implement the proposed work then it is contrasted with previous techniques such as Ant Colony Optimization algorithm (ACO) and Improved Whale Optimization algorithm (IWOA) respectively. Significantly, the CAEHO protocol enhances the packet delivery ratio, throughput and comparatively reduces overhead than other routing protocols.続きを見る
